8. Instalar Docker Y Docker Compose

  Instalando Docker y Docker con Podman en Linux (Ubuntu/Debian)

¡Hoy vamos a configurar Docker y Podman (una alternativa ligera y sin daemon) en nuestra máquina! Sigue estos pasos para tener todo listo y empezar a trabajar con contenedores.

1. Instalar Docker

Ejecutamos el siguiente comando:

bash
sudo apt-get install docker.io -y

Esperamos a que termine la instalación.

🔹 Iniciar el servicio de Docker:

bash
sudo systemctl enable --now docker

🔹 Verificar la versión instalada:

bash
docker --version

(Ejemplo de salida: Docker version 20.10.12)


2. Instalar Podman (alternativa a Docker) y Docker Compose

Podman es más liviano y no requiere un daemon en segundo plano:

bash
sudo apt-get install podman docker-compose -y

3. Configurar permisos (evitar usar sudo con Docker)

🔹 Verificar si existe el grupo docker:

bash
sudo grep docker /etc/group

🔹 Agregar tu usuario al grupo docker:

bash
sudo usermod -aG docker $USER

🔹 Reiniciar la sesión del grupo:

bash
newgrp docker

4. Probar que todo funcione

Ejecutamos un contenedor de prueba sin sudo:

bash
docker run hello-world

✅ Si ves el mensaje "Hello from Docker!", ¡todo está listo!


¿Qué sigue?

En el próximo tutorial, configuraremos:

  • 🐋 Archivos Dockerfile y docker-compose.yml para Laravel.

  • 🛠️ Integración con Podman para entornos más eficientes.

¿Te gustaría un enfoque en algún tema en particular? ¡Déjalo en los comentarios! 👇

#Docker #Podman #DevOps #Laravel #Containers

Comentarios

Entradas más populares de este blog

14. Publish and Detached modes

12. Hola Mundo en Docker.

11¿Qué es Docker? y ¿Por qué debo saberlo?